Weather Patterns in Iceland During March are Primarily Influenced by the Jet Stream
Iceland’s unique location in the North Atlantic, where the mid-latitude westerlies meet the polar jet stream, makes it susceptible to dramatic weather fluctuations. During March, the jet stream plays a crucial role in shaping Iceland’s weather patterns, with its fast-moving bands of air influencing temperature, precipitation, and wind conditions.
The jet stream is a fast-moving band of air located in the upper atmosphere, typically above 20,000 feet. In March, the jet stream’s position and speed can significantly impact Iceland’s climate, leading to rapid temperature fluctuations and unpredictable weather. Two ways the temperature fluctuations in the jet stream impact Iceland’s climate are:
Temperature Fluctuations and Impacts on Climate
When the jet stream moves closer to Iceland, it brings warm, moist air from the Gulf Stream, resulting in mild temperatures and increased precipitation. This can lead to the formation of weather systems such as low-pressure systems and fronts, which can bring heavy rain and strong winds to the island. Conversely, when the jet stream moves away from Iceland, cold Arctic air is drawn closer, causing temperatures to drop significantly and precipitation to decrease.
The Role of Atmospheric Pressure in Shaping Weather Systems
Atmospheric pressure also plays a crucial role in shaping Iceland’s weather systems in March. When high-pressure systems dominate the region, they can bring clear skies and light winds, leading to cold temperatures and minimal precipitation. Conversely, low-pressure systems can bring cloud cover, precipitation, and strong winds, making it challenging to predict the weather.

The Aurora Borealis is a Common Sight in Iceland in March: Weather In March In Iceland
The Aurora Borealis, also known as the Northern Lights, is a breathtaking natural phenomenon that can be witnessed in the night sky of Iceland in March. This spectacular display of colored lights is caused by charged particles from the sun interacting with the Earth’s magnetic field and atmosphere. Iceland’s unique location under the auroral oval, a region around the North Pole where the aurora is most active, makes it an ideal destination for witnessing the Aurora Borealis.
The scientific explanation behind the Aurora Borealis involves the Earth’s magnetic field deflecting charged particles from the sun, which then collide with atoms and molecules in the atmosphere. This collision causes the atoms and molecules to become excited, resulting in the emission of light. The color of the light depends on the energy of the particles and the altitude at which they collide with the atmosphere. Green is the most common color, produced by collisions at altitudes of around 100-200 km, while red is produced by collisions at higher altitudes.
Best Places to Witness the Aurora Borealis in Iceland
The best places to see the Aurora Borealis in Iceland include:
The Reykjanes Peninsula, particularly in the areas around Reykjanesbær and Keflavík, is known for its dark skies and minimal light pollution, making it an ideal location for stargazing and aurora viewing.
The Snæfellsnes Peninsula, with its unique landscapes and rugged coastline, offers a great combination of scenic views and opportunities for aurora spotting.
Lake Mývatn, a popular destination known for its geothermal activity and natural beauty, is also a great spot to witness the Aurora Borealis due to its remote location and low light pollution.
Vatnajökull National Park, Europe’s largest national park, offers a vast and pristine landscape where visitors can witness the aurora in a truly immersive environment.

What are the average temperature ranges in Reykjavik, Akureyri, and the Eastfjords in March?
The average temperature ranges in Reykjavik, Akureyri, and the Eastfjords in March are 2-4°C (36-39°F), 0-2°C (32-36°F), and -2 to 0°C (28-32°F) respectively.
